Carmen

Friday, Nov 6 8:00p
at Overture Center for Arts, Madison, WI
Age Suitability: None Specified

Sung in French with projected English subtitles

Madison Opera's 2009-2010 Season opens with Georges Bizet’s passion filled Carmen. Rich,evocative
sets and Bizet's sultry and seductive music will transport audiences to Seville for this classic tragedy
of love and lust. Mezzo-soprano Katharine Goeldner brings her acclaimed Carmen to Madison Opera,
here supported by an exciting young cast includingd Adam Diegel. Elizabeth Caballero and Hyung Yun.
With Maestro John DeMain conducting and stage direction by Madison native Candace Evans.
Carmen offers an exhilarating start to Madison Opera’s 49th season.
